About this role

About the Role:

The Returns Specialist plays a critical role in managing and optimizing the product return process to ensure customer satisfaction and operational efficiency. This position involves handling return requests, inspecting returned merchandise, and coordinating with various departments such as logistics, customer service, and inventory management. The specialist will analyze return data to identify trends and recommend improvements to reduce return rates and enhance product quality. They will also ensure comp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ements related to returns and refunds. Ultimately, the Returns Specialist contributes to maintaining a positive customer experience while minimizing financial losses associated with product returns.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Experience in customer service, retail, or logistics with exposure to returns processing.
  • Basic computer skills, including proficiency with Microsoft Office and inventory management systems.
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Ability to communicate clearly and professionally with customers and internal teams.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Associate’s degree or higher in business administration, supply chain management, or a related field.
  • Experience using returns management software or ERP systems.
  • Knowledge of product lifecycle and quality control processes.
  • Analytical skills to interpret return data and recommend process improvements.
  • Familiarity with regulatory requirements related to product returns and consumer protection.

Responsibilities:

  • Process and evaluate customer return requests promptly and accurately according to company policies.
  • Inspect returned products to assess condition and determine appropriate disposition, such as restocking, refurbishing, or disposal.
  • Coordinate with customer service, warehouse, and finance teams to resolve return-related issues and ensure timely refunds or exchanges.
  • Maintain detailed records of returns and generate reports to track return rates, reasons, and financial impact.
  • Identify patterns or recurring issues in returns and collaborate with relevant departments to implement corrective actions.

Skills:

The Returns Specialist uses strong communication skills daily to interact effectively with customers and internal teams, ensuring clarity and professionalism in all exchanges. Attention to detail is essential when inspecting returned products and documenting return information accurately to maintain data integrity. Analytical skills are applied to review return trends and identify opportunities for process enhancements that reduce costs and improve customer satisfaction. Proficiency with computer systems and software enables efficient processing of returns and generation of insightful reports. Additionally, problem-solving skills help the specialist address complex return cases and collaborate with other departments to implement effective solutions.

About Fenix Parts Inc

Fenix Parts is a leading recycler and reseller of original equipment manufacturer automotive products in the United States. The Fenix companies currently operate from over 30 locations with decades of experience. Our primary business is auto recycling, which is the recovery and resale of OEM parts, components and systems reclaimed from damaged, totaled or low value vehicles.
